Compartir a través de


SecurityTokenValidatedContext Clase

Definición

Objeto de contexto utilizado para SecurityTokenValidated(SecurityTokenValidatedContext).

public ref class SecurityTokenValidatedContext : Microsoft::AspNetCore::Authentication::RemoteAuthenticationContext<Microsoft::AspNetCore::Authentication::WsFederation::WsFederationOptions ^>
public class SecurityTokenValidatedContext : Microsoft.AspNetCore.Authentication.RemoteAuthenticationContext<Microsoft.AspNetCore.Authentication.WsFederation.WsFederationOptions>
type SecurityTokenValidatedContext = class
    inherit RemoteAuthenticationContext<WsFederationOptions>
Public Class SecurityTokenValidatedContext
Inherits RemoteAuthenticationContext(Of WsFederationOptions)
Herencia

Constructores

SecurityTokenValidatedContext(HttpContext, AuthenticationScheme, WsFederationOptions, ClaimsPrincipal, AuthenticationProperties)

Crea una SecurityTokenValidatedContext

Propiedades

HttpContext

Contexto.

(Heredado de BaseContext<TOptions>)
Options

Obtiene las opciones de autenticación asociadas al esquema.

(Heredado de BaseContext<TOptions>)
Principal

Obtiene el ClaimsPrincipal objeto que contiene las notificaciones del usuario.

(Heredado de RemoteAuthenticationContext<TOptions>)
Properties

Obtiene o establece el AuthenticationProperties.

(Heredado de RemoteAuthenticationContext<TOptions>)
ProtocolMessage

Objeto WsFederationMessage recibido en esta solicitud.

Request

La solicitud.

(Heredado de BaseContext<TOptions>)
Response

Respuesta.

(Heredado de BaseContext<TOptions>)
Result

que HandleRequestResult usa el controlador.

(Heredado de HandleRequestContext<TOptions>)
Scheme

Esquema de autenticación.

(Heredado de BaseContext<TOptions>)
SecurityToken

que SecurityToken se validó.

Métodos

Fail(Exception)

Indica que se produjo un error en la autenticación.

(Heredado de RemoteAuthenticationContext<TOptions>)
Fail(String)

Indica que se produjo un error en la autenticación.

(Heredado de RemoteAuthenticationContext<TOptions>)
HandleResponse()

Interrumpe todo el procesamiento para esta solicitud y vuelve al cliente. El llamador es el responsable de generar la respuesta completa.

(Heredado de HandleRequestContext<TOptions>)
SkipHandler()

Deje de procesar la solicitud en el controlador actual.

(Heredado de HandleRequestContext<TOptions>)
Success()

Llama a success creating a ticket with the Principal y Properties.

(Heredado de RemoteAuthenticationContext<TOptions>)

Se aplica a